Show
Ignore:
Timestamp:
11/28/09 14:38:48 (14 years ago)
Author:
smidl
Message:

Working unitsteps and controlloop + corresponding fixes

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• applications/pmsm/pmsmDS.h

    r686 r744  
    118118    void log_register ( logger &L ) 
    119119    { 
    120         L_x = L.add ( rx, "x" ); 
    121         L_oy = L.add ( ry, "o" ); 
    122         L_ou = L.add ( ru, "o" ); 
    123         L_iu = L.add ( ru, "t" ); 
     120        L_x = L.add_vector ( rx, "x" ); 
     121        L_oy = L.add_vector ( ry, "o" ); 
     122        L_ou = L.add_vector ( ru, "o" ); 
     123        L_iu = L.add_vector ( ru, "t" ); 
    124124        // log differences 
    125125        if ( opt_modu ) 
    126126        { 
    127             L_optu = L.add ( ru, "model" ); 
     127            L_optu = L.add_vector ( ru, "model" ); 
    128128        } 
    129129    } 
     
    131131    void log_write ( logger &L ) 
    132132    { 
    133         L.logit ( L_x, vec ( x,4 )      ); 
    134         L.logit ( L_oy, vec_2 ( KalmanObs[2],KalmanObs[3] ) ); 
    135         L.logit ( L_ou, vec_2 ( KalmanObs[0],KalmanObs[1] ) ); 
    136         L.logit ( L_iu, vec_2 ( KalmanObs[4],KalmanObs[5] ) ); 
     133        L.log_vector ( L_x, vec ( x,4 ) ); 
     134        L.log_vector ( L_oy, vec_2 ( KalmanObs[2],KalmanObs[3] ) ); 
     135        L.log_vector ( L_ou, vec_2 ( KalmanObs[0],KalmanObs[1] ) ); 
     136        L.log_vector ( L_iu, vec_2 ( KalmanObs[4],KalmanObs[5] ) ); 
    137137        if ( opt_modu ) 
    138138        { 
     
    151151            ua = ( 2.0* ( u1-du1 )- ( u2-du2 )- ( u3-du3 ) ) /3.0; 
    152152            ub = ( ( u2-du2 )- ( u3-du3 ) ) /sq3; 
    153             L.logit ( L_optu , vec_2 ( ua,ub ) ); 
     153            L.log_vector ( L_optu , vec_2 ( ua,ub ) ); 
    154154        } 
    155155 
     
    238238    void log_add(logger &L, const string &name="" ) 
    239239    { 
    240         L_CRB=L.add(rx,"crb"); 
    241         L_err=L.add(rx,"err"); 
    242         L_sec=L.add(rx,"d2"); 
     240        L_CRB=L.add_vector(rx,"crb"); 
     241        L_err=L.add_vector(rx,"err"); 
     242        L_sec=L.add_vector(rx,"d2"); 
    243243    } 
    244244    void logit(logger &L) 
    245245    { 
    246         L.logit(L_err, interr); 
    247         L.logit(L_CRB,diag(_R())); 
    248         L.logit(L_sec,secder); 
     246        L.log_vector(L_err, interr); 
     247        L.log_vector(L_CRB,diag(_R())); 
     248        L.log_vector(L_sec,secder); 
    249249    } 
    250250 
     
    322322    void log_add(logger &L, const string &name="" ) 
    323323    { 
    324         L_CRB=L.add(concat(rx,RV("Mz",1,0)),"crbz"); 
     324        L_CRB=L.add_vector(concat(rx,RV("Mz",1,0)),"crbz"); 
    325325    } 
    326326    void logit(logger &L) 
    327327    { 
    328         L.logit(L_CRB,diag(_R())); 
     328        L.log_vector(L_CRB,diag(_R())); 
    329329    } 
    330330